i just got little more info from them. they said:
"It will be released Jan '07. And the intake will be complete except for mounting hardware , gaskets , fuel rails , and throttle body . Your factory parts can be used . avilable in natural aluminum finish, and polshed look. We can not release exact date, or our dyno numbers. But the gain were comparable to that of Special edition mustang intake, but they are as twice as much as our projected MSRP will be."
